Transaction 3ade5411b61784c994d181e0163f0ad09457f714492c2cd3a7a380b99c0eefde
1 Input
1 Output
-
3ade5411b61784c994d181e0163f0ad09457f714492c2cd3a7a380b99c0eefde:0
- value
- 10544668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 668c02fb1c934b4a8e167e475543a774f841cda7 OP_EQUAL
- address
- 3B3EaHmwo2j9mjpq5Z2YivM27UbyRuKEav